Types of Medications Used in Mental Health Treatment

There's no one-size-fits-all when it concerns psychological health and wellness medications. Below's a failure of some typical kinds:

Antidepressants:
    SSRIs SNRIs (Serotonin-Norepinephrine Reuptake Inhibitors) Tricyclics
Anti-anxiety medications:
    Benzodiazepines Buspirone
Mood stabilizers:
    Lithium Anticonvulsants
Antipsychotics:
    Atypical antipsychotics Typical antipsychotics

FAQs about Medicine in Mental Wellness Treatment

1. What types of medicines are commonly recommended for anxiety disorders?

Medications frequently include SSRIs like fluoxetine or sertraline and benzodiazepines like diazepam for short-term management.

2. The length of time does it take for psychological medications to work?

Generally speaking, antidepressants may take several weeks-- generally 4 to 6 weeks-- to show recognizable effects.

3. Are there adverse effects associated with these medications?

Yes, side effects can vary based upon the sort of drug yet commonly include queasiness, weight gain, or exhaustion; however, they typically reduce over time.

4. Can I quit taking my drug if I really feel better?

Never stop taking your suggested medication without consulting your doctor first; doing so might result in withdrawal signs and symptoms or relapse.
